Solution

The correct option is A Secretin
Pancreatic juice is composed of digestive enzymes and bicarbonate. The release of pancreatic juice is regulated by two hormones, secretin and cholecystokinin. Secretin hormone helps regulate the pH of the duodenum. It inhibits the secretion of gastric acid. It also stimulates the acinar cells of the pancreas to release water and bicarbonate into the pancreatic ducts.
Thus, the correct answer is option A.
